It seems simple.

Water. Yeast. Grains. Hops. That’s all it takes to make beer. But what we do with those simple ingredients within these walls is what makes us special.

Foothills began brewing beer at our West 4th Street location in March 2005, with three 15-barrel fermenters. Jamie and his brewers managed to crank out 800 barrels of beer that year, and doubled that output the following year.

As demand and production continued to increase, the need became obvious for more space. The solution came in the form of a 48,000 square foot warehouse a few miles away, an old manila envelope factory that was retro-fitted with brewing equipment and became Foothills’ main production facility, located at 3800 Kimwell Drive.

Today both brewery locations continue to produce our top-quality beers. We offer weekend tours from our tasting room at our main brewing facility. Conversely, if you ask nicely at the downtown brewpub, you can probably get a peek at the operation.

6.6/10 Appearance 8 Aroma 7 Flavor 6 Texture 6 Overall 6.5
Crisp and ever so slightly hazy amber and almost deep brown coloured body, all with a thinnish, single centimetre tall tan head that fades on the quick side. Aroma of nuts, toffee, caramelised sugatrs, a dash of apples and pears with a little bit of spices and a touch of hay at the end. Medium-bodied; Spicey flavour at first with a lot more caramelised sugar flavours and a dash of grain towards the end along with a touch of hay and a good nutty finish with a healthy hand of earthy malts as well. Aftertaste shows a good balance of the spices and the malts with a lot of sugars and almost no hop flavours at all, which is okay. Overall, a nice and polished vienna that has a decidedly spicey and nutty profile that is crisp and enjoyable even without any real hop flavours throughout, but the sugars and light fruity flavours provide the good balance.
